INDEPENDENCE, Ohio, July 20 — D.B. Kenner was reelected by acclamation to his second term as Chairman of the Montana State Legislative Board during its quadrennial meeting in Billings, Mont., June 22-23, 2016.
A BNSF locomotive engineer, Brother Kenner is a member of BLET Division 195 in Forsyth, Mont. He has held continuous membership since joining the Brotherhood on September 1, 2004. Brother Kenner served the Board as Secretary-Treasurer immediately prior to his election to the Chairman’s office in 2012.
Also reelected by acclamation to their second terms were: 1st Vice Chairman Jim S. Cowan, Division 262 (Missoula, Mont.); 2nd Vice Chairman Rob C. Davison, Division 499 (Whitefish, Mont.); and Secretary-Treasurer Kris L. Melone, Division 504 (Great Falls, Mont.). Brother Tyler D. Partridge of BLET Division 298 (Glasgow, Mont.) was elected by acclamation to his first term as Alternate Secretary-Treasurer.
“Congratulations to Brother Kenner and all officers of the Montana State Legislative Board,” BLET National President Dennis R. Pierce said. “I thank them for their willingness to serve our Brothers and Sisters in the great state of Montana. I also wish to recognize Brother Craig Gilchrist. Thank you for your years of service as Chairman of the Montana State Legislative Board and best wishes on your upcoming retirement.”
Elected by acclamation to serve as members of the Audit Committee were: Barry E. Green, Division 180 (Glendive, Mont.); Paul A. Slater, Division 232 (Laurel, Mont.); and Jerry D. Hedalen, Division 392 (Havre, Mont.).
Brother Cory L. Runion, Wyoming State Legislative Board Chairman, was a guest speaker during the meeting. He is a member of Division 115 (Cheyenne, Wyo.) who also serves the BLET as Region 4 Chairman of the National Association of State Legislative Board Chairmen (NASLBC).
Additional guest speakers included: Amanda Frickle, Director of the Montana Democratic Legislative Campaign Committee; Ken Naylor, Chief Inspector from the Federal Railroad Administration based in Billings, Mont.; and Zachary Zagata, Operating Practices Inspector with the FRA out of Great Falls, Mont.
Members of the Board and delegates recognized and thanked Craig Gilchrist in advance of his pending retirement. Brother Gilchrist began serving the Montana State Legislative Board Chairman in 1989 and served as its Chairman for 16 years (1996-2012).
The delegates also discussed a number of issues impacting the health, safety, and working conditions of BLET members in Montana. They discussed the upcoming national elections and voted to endorse candidates running for various elected offices in the state.
The BLET’s Montana State Legislative Board was founded on May 17, 1904, and represents approximately 1,200 active and retired members in eight BLET Divisions.
